Dancing While Playing?

Sign in to disble this ad
I just saw your BPLive clinic and I was very impressed! Your definitely a world class player. I was particularly amazed at your ability to play while dancing around. I have tried dancing around during shows and it affects my playing too much. I have thought about practicing it but I think I'm a big enough loser as it is

How did you get your moves? You're doing some difficult stuff: Isn't it difficult to pick the strings when the whole entire bass is moving with you?

Glenn,

thanks for your kind words.

As far as the dancing thing goes, it came naturally after some time of doing it. I don't really have any single major thing that helped me to be able to dance and play at the same time. But the main thing for sure is to have your playing ability being second nature. If you don't have to think at all about your technique, your sound, the song you're playing...... then dancing is going to be pretty easy. And also, don't lose sight of the fact that music is generally for dancing to..... so if you're playing something fat and grooving you should want to dance to it....
